Applying for advancement to ASCE fellow

To apply for fellow, complete the fellow application and submit it to the Membership Application Review Committee (MARC). The minimum requirements are ten years of responsible charge in the grade of member* and a P.E. or P.L.S. license. There is no direct admission to the grade of fellow.

Members may request a waiver of specific requirements.

Applicants for the fellow grade should provide the following:

  • Completed fellow application form (PDF) 
  • Nomination form (PDF) completed by an authorized representative of an ASCE Organizational Entity (for example, section or branch president, Board of Direction members, institute board of governors member, technical committee chair, etc.)
  • Copy of Professional Engineer or Professional Land Surveyor license (U.S. or international)
  • Completed testimonial reference forms (PDF) from three references (two must be from ASCE fellows or higher grade of membership; the third may be from an ASCE member or higher grade of membership)  
    • There is a membership directory available to help locate your colleagues who are members and fellows.  
  • Copy of resume or CV

All applications for the fellow grade are thoroughly reviewed by the Membership Application Review Committee (MARC), which meets monthly as needed.
